Olympic Happy Hour: July 27

Throughout the Olympics, Horse Nation will be capping off each day with a pint-sized synopsis of the most recent Olympic equestrian sporting festivities. Here’s your Happy Hour report for Friday, July 27.

Today’s big news was that, despite a few tense moments and some unfortunate team jog outfit fashion choices (why encourage blindingly-pale British people to wear shorts in public?), all of the event horses passed the jog.

via @spikethevet

Eventing dressage begins tomorrow and runs through Sunday; the full schedule of ride times is here.

And, of course, later in the day Olympic spectators were treated to an extravagant Opening Ceremonies dreamed up by Oscar-winning director Danny Boyle (Slumdog Millionaire). I couldn’t make heads or tails of the thing without getting dizzy, but the New York Times has a thoughtful write-up here.
